A new method to rapidly produce and screen polymer-, xerogel-, bioceramic- and bioglass-based formulations is described. The approach is based on a high- speed pin printer and imaging with an epi-fluorescence microscope/charge coupled device detector. By using this method one can produce and screen over 600 formulations/hr and rapidly identify lead formulations and/or compositions that are useful for the development of devices such as medical devices and (bio)sensors.
